可切换的类素骨架编辑,通过循环连续重排使之成为可能
Di Tian1, Yu-Ping He1,2, Lu-Sen Yang1
1Shanghai Frontiers Science Center for Drug Target Identification and Delivery, Laboratory of Innovative Immunotherapy, and Shanghai Key Laboratory for Molecular Engineering of Chiral Drugs, School of Pharmaceutical Sciences, Shanghai Jiao Tong University, Shanghai, China.
这项研究提出了一种修改素结构的新方法,产生各种含化合物和线性分子. 这种方法使可调节的骨架编辑用于药物发现应用.

SN1 Reaction: Stereochemistry
In the first step of an SN1 reaction, the bond between the electrophilic carbon and the leaving group ionizes to generate the carbocation intermediate. The second step of the mechanism is the nucleophilic attack.
